Phospho-p70 S6 Kinase (Thr389) (1A5) Mouse mAb #9206
Phospho-p70 S6 Kinase (Thr389) (1A5) Mouse mAb detects endogenous levels of p70 S6 kinase only when phosphorylated at Thr389. This antibody also detects p85 S6 kinase when phosphorylated at the analogous site (Thr412) and possibly S6KII phosphorylated at Thr388. Human, Mouse, Rat, Monkey, D. melanogaster.

Serine 389 phosphorylation of 3-phosphoinositide-dependent …
Jul 7, 2020 · In the present study, we showed that ULK1 phosphorylated Ser389 of PDK1 at the linker region. This phosphorylation did not affect the kinase activity of PDK1. However, the nonphosphorylatable mutant of PDK1 showed weak activity toward the downstream kinases, such as Akt and p70S6k.
Ultraviolet-induced Phosphorylation of p70 - American …
Oct 15, 2002 · Exposure of cells to UV radiation led to marked increases in p70 S6k activity and phosphorylation at Thr 389 and Thr 421 /Ser 424. UV radiation also generated reactive oxygen species as measured by electron spin resonance and by H 2 O 2 and O ⨪ 2 fluorescence staining assays in JB6 Cl 41 cells.
mTOR and S6K1 Mediate Assembly of the Translation ... - Cell Press
Nov 18, 2005 · We show that mTOR and S6K1 maneuver on and off the eukaryotic initiation factor 3 (eIF3) translation initiation complex in a signal-dependent, choreographed fashion. When inactive, S6K1 associates with the eIF3 complex, while the S6K1 activator mTOR/raptor does not.

Distinct Roles of mTOR Targets S6K1 and S6K2 in Breast Cancer
Feb 11, 2020 · The immunosuppressant drug rapamycin and its analogs that inhibit mTOR are currently being evaluated for their potential as anti-cancer agents, albeit with limited efficacy. mTORC1 mediates its function via its downstream targets 40S ribosomal S6 kinases (S6K) and eukaryotic translation initiation factor 4E (eIF4E)-binding protein 1 (4E-BP1).
